John E. Loustalot was elected Sheriff in January 1939 and served until January 1951. He was the second of five men to serve three four-year terms as Kern County Sheriff. Sheriff Loustalot was responsible for establishing the Reserve Organization and the Sheriff’s Mounted Posse. After leaving the Office of Sheriff in January 1951, he went on ...Detective Section. From Mill Valley to San Rafael, California’s Marin County is the per...Dec 22, 2020 · SACRAMENTO – California Attorney General Xavier Becerra today announced a major settlement aimed at reforming a wide range of practices at the Kern County Sheriff’s Office (KCSO). The agreement comes after an extensive investigation by the California Department of Justice (DOJ) and constructive action by KCSO to begin the reform process that will benefit all Kern County residents. Effective February 4, 2010, the Bakersfield Police Department began processing … The Kern County Sheriff’s Office is pleased to announce the resolution of a cold case nearly 40 years in the making. Kern County Jane Doe #5 was found stabbed to death on July 14, 1980 in an almond orchard just north of Bakersfield, CA. In February of 2020, 39 years later, Jane Doe was finally identified.
